Remembering ‘Big Brother’ Star Mickey Lee on What Would Have Been Her 36th Birthday

Fans are remembering Mickey Lee on what would have been her 36th birthday.

The “Big Brother” season 27 standout passed away on December 25, 2025, at age 35 after suffering multiple cardiac arrests following complications related to the flu. Her family confirmed the news in a statement shared on Instagram at the time, writing that her “light, legacy, and impact will never be forgotten.”

As her birthday on March 31 arrived, tributes from fans reflected on the impact she left behind.

Mickey Lee’s Impact on ‘Big Brother’

Mickey LeeCBS
Mickey Lee on “Big Brother” Season 27

During her time on season 27, Lee became known for her bold gameplay and willingness to make major moves.

One of her most memorable moments came when she won a power that allowed her to take over a Head of Household reign. She used that power to take control of Rylie Jeffries’ week and target ally Jimmy Heagerty, a move that reshaped the house dynamic and elevated her threat level.

As other players began to recognize her as a strong competitor, Lee found herself repeatedly fighting to stay in the game. She won competitions at key moments, extending her time in the house before ultimately being evicted on day 59, just before the jury phase, finishing in 10th place.

Shortly before she was hospitalized, Lee spoke about her outlook on life during an appearance on the “Hip Hop United LLC” podcast.

“I wake up and I thank God everyday that I’m here,” she said. “I’m happy when that happens. I have another day. I have clothes on my back, I have food on the table and I have my village.”
